Latest CTA Update: BOI Deadline Pushed to January 13, Court Drama Continues

Here we go again. On Monday, December 23, the U.S. Fifth Circuit Court of Appeals lifted the preliminary injunction that had halted enforcement of CTA reporting guidelines for nearly all privately held corporations, partnerships, and LLCs doing business in the U.S. Shortly after the decision was announced, FinCEN – the agency tasked with enforcing the…

CTA Update: Court Halts Enforcement of BOI Requirements, Deadline in Limbo

On Tuesday, December 3, the U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of Texas granted a nationwide preliminary injunction enjoining enforcement of CTA reporting requirements and putting a stay on the January 1, 2025 compliance deadline. While the government quickly filed an appeal, FinCEN – the agency tasked with enforcing the BOI reporting requirements –…
